Builder’s Reputation

If you are buying a home in a community, it’s most likely going to bear the name of a builder. And the builder’s name is one of the driving factors behind a property’s value. 

A reputable builder not only delivers exceptionally built homes but also ensures buyers of the best returns down the road. As a homeowner, you will have an easy time finding potential buyers if you choose to sell your property later. Plus, you will get more than the fair market value. This may not be the case if your community’s builder isn’t well known.

Community’s Location

Communities and homes located in well-developed and approved areas hold a higher value than those located in lesser developed areas or away from commercial markets. Plus, those in proximity to hospitals, shopping malls, schools, universities, banks, and facilities frequently visited by families are often in high demand, skyrocketing their value every year. So, when looking for a home in a community, make sure the community is well-connected with the other parts of the city and located close to commercial markets.
